#checksum #file-tree #recursion #error #prints #success #core

app treesum

在所有核心上计算文件树的校验和

3 个版本

使用旧的 Rust 2015

0.1.2 2019年8月24日
0.1.1 2018年12月25日
0.1.0 2018年12月20日

#11 in #success

Apache-2.0/MIT

9KB
95

treesum

并行 SHA-1 校验和计算器,用于文件树。

  • 输出与 sha1sum 兼容的格式 (sha1sum --check FILE)。
  • 遍历输入目录及其所有子目录。
  • 每个核心一个工作线程,每个线程处理一个文件。
  • 将校验和打印到 stdout。
  • 将错误打印到 stderr。
  • 成功时返回 0。

变更日志

0.1.2

  • 更新了依赖。

0.1.1

  • 更新了依赖。

0.1.0

  • 第一个版本。

依赖项

~3–12MB
~114K SLoC